It’s likely that the multiplayer title is The Last of Us 2’s delayed Factions multiplayer mode, which has possibly been expanded into a full standalone title.
The job ads also match with comments made by PlayStation Studios boss Herman Hulst this month, who hinted at a narrative-driven online experience coming from PlayStation. “Who says that multiplayer experience cannot have great stories, right?” He said.
The Last of Us Part 2 director and Naughty Dog vice president Neil Druckmann announced in September 2019 that The Last of Us Part 2 wouldn’t include a multiplayer component as originally planned because the studio “wanted to take all of the resources to make this the biggest game we’ve ever done”.
However, in a follow-up statement, Naughty Dog pledged to release a new Last of Us multiplayer offering after its work on the sequel was complete.
“You will eventually experience the fruits of our team’s online ambition, but not as part of The Last of Us Part II,” it said. “When and where it will be realized is still to be determined. But rest assured, we are as big a fan as Factions as the rest of our community and are excited to share more when it’s ready.”
